NEW YORK (AP) Fans who hear the whirring sound of a drone over a stadium might see it as a nuisance, but law enforcement has long viewed those aircraft as a potential weapon of mass destruction.
With the World Cup about to kick off, security is heightened and there’s a zero-tolerance policy for drones over or near stadiums during the 78 matches in 11 U.S. cities.
